Lines Matching refs:xhci_ring
126 static void xhci_link_rings(struct xhci_hcd *xhci, struct xhci_ring *ring, in xhci_link_rings()
151 void xhci_ring_free(struct xhci_hcd *xhci, struct xhci_ring *ring) in xhci_ring_free()
162 static void xhci_initialize_ring_info(struct xhci_ring *ring, in xhci_initialize_ring_info()
234 static struct xhci_ring *xhci_ring_alloc(struct xhci_hcd *xhci, in xhci_ring_alloc()
238 struct xhci_ring *ring; in xhci_ring_alloc()
298 struct xhci_ring *ring, unsigned int cycle_state, in xhci_reinit_cached_ring()
328 int xhci_ring_expansion(struct xhci_hcd *xhci, struct xhci_ring *ring, in xhci_ring_expansion()
468 struct xhci_ring *xhci_dma_to_transfer_ring( in xhci_dma_to_transfer_ring()
480 static struct xhci_ring *dma_to_stream_ring( in dma_to_stream_ring()
489 struct xhci_ring *xhci_stream_id_to_ring( in xhci_stream_id_to_ring()
512 struct xhci_ring *cur_ring; in xhci_test_radix_tree()
516 struct xhci_ring *mapped_ring; in xhci_test_radix_tree()
603 struct xhci_ring *cur_ring; in xhci_alloc_stream_info()
626 sizeof(struct xhci_ring *)*num_streams, in xhci_alloc_stream_info()
759 struct xhci_ring *cur_ring; in xhci_free_stream_info()
975 sizeof(struct xhci_ring *)*XHCI_MAX_RINGS_CACHED, in xhci_alloc_virt_device()
1003 struct xhci_ring *ep_ring; in xhci_copy_ep0_dequeue_into_input_ctx()
1406 struct xhci_ring *ep_ring; in xhci_endpoint_init()